Tim Barry: 28th & Stonewall

Ex-lead singer of Avail (a band I've heard of but couldn't name one song from, but apparently means something to some people) puts out his third solo album and it's pretty dang good. Mostly a rootsy, Americana , folksy kinda thing that rocks a bit in places. His voice has an earnest quality that lends itself well to this setting. Just starting to get a listen to this so haven't firmly made up my mind but sio far so good if not a lot of variation. Alt-country, folk fans will dig this.
